A Lesson in Truth.

There’s an old saying I’m quite fond of: ‘Water that is too pure contains no fish.’  It is derived from the text if Ts’ai Ken Tan, compiled by Hong Zicheng during the time of the Ming dynasty.

“Still that is dirt grows countless things,” he writes. It is intended to demonstrate the truth of our experience, that we must engage the messiness in order to get to the meaning.

Though, so often our approach is to exclude – to set aside that which we deem impure. But the reality, my friends, is quite simple – it is impossible to live in a space of perfection.

Instead, we must learn to embrace that which ultimately helps us to grow – and recognizing our awakening is a continuous unfolding.
